1. Golden Nugget Casino
The largest casino in downtown Vegas is the Golden Nugget. Covering over 38,000 square feet, it was initially built in 1946 and has been renovated over the years, adding into a new Las Vegas hotel tower. The casino earns its name "Golden Nugget" because the world's largest nugget of gold, 27.21kg, is located in the hotel's lobby. The Nugget originally was found in the 1980s and then later sold to this casino.
2. Four Queens Hotel and Casino
The world's biggest slot machines are located here, making Four Queens Casino a key attraction for gamblers. This Casino has been in operation since 1966 and has been consistent in delivering high-quality gaming, and entertainment.

4. Fremont Hotel and Casino
If you're new to gambling, this is the place to start, as Fremont offers blackjack and craps from $3. Other table games include Pai Gow poker and Let It Ride. You will also find some of the hottest new slot machines here or you can try a few classic slot games. The Fremont also offers a full race and sportsbook. On this entire casino floor, you are sure to find a game or two that interests you.
5. Circa Resort and Casino
Planning to open on October 28th,2020, the Circa casino will be the first casino to feature the world's largest sportsbook. Sports bettors will enjoy three levels of sports action on high definition screens. The Circa casino has also announced to have its own studio to offer in-depth analysis of sports to the bettors.
